We provide free one-to-one business advisement to businesses in the Columbia Basin. We are funded by @TheTrustInfo and administered by Kootenay Peaks Advisory.

The Fairs, Festivals and Events Recovery Fund provides one-time grants to event organizers to support the safe restart of events across British Columbia. Funds are limited & grants will be awarded through a competitive process. ~ More info: https://t.co/uZLCWf5AQr

B.C. announces new recovery fund for fairs, festivals and events!
news.gov.bc.ca
The Province will begin accepting applications on Friday, Aug. 27, 2021, to support B.C.-based events through the new Fairs, Festivals and Events Recovery Fund.
